Calf Jeans

I am one of those people, that loves to use up materials to the maximum possible and hates waste. So, when I have big remnants of fabric, I save them for later smaller projects, to be combined with other remnants, if possible.

Last year I made a pair of flared jeans out of a dark blue denim with lycra and I had about 60 cm  left. I had also some mere scraps from the jeans I made for Gaby, which are of the same fabric type and weight, only a different shade of color - asphalt grey.

I could have made a pair of jeans shorts, but I much prefer calf length jeans for the summer, so I decided to do my best and try to squeeze a pair out of my meager remnants.

For the pattern I used again the Flared Burda jeans, but in their shorter calf-length version. This pattern features flared hems, but I preferred to add simple rectangular hems, as I wanted my jeans to be straight calf length capri type pants.
 
For most of the details of the pair I used the bigger dark-blue piece of denim and I cut the back yoke, and the hems out of the grey denim.
 
I was so short of fabric, that I had to make the inside of the waistband out of a third piece of denim - a remnant from my black jeans and the back pockets are made of small scraps of fabric.
 
Size: 34, short version, with corrections
Fabric: cotton denim with lycra
Time to make: 10 days

I can totally afford to buy a new piece of fabric and make myself any number of pairs of jeans, but that is not the point - my complete satisfaction lies in the fact, that I managed to use up my remnants and I have a perfectly functional pair of jeans, which I've been wearing regularly. Bistritza - Zeleznitza 2025

The low altitude circuit trail on Vitosha is at its prime at the end of May and June, when it is in full green mode, with lots of flowers and blooming trees. We love to frequent various parts of it at this time of the year, today we chose the most popular of them all, only some 30 min by car from home - the section between the villages of Bistritza and Zeleznitza and back.

Unlike previous rainy years, June is warm and sunny this year, with just a touch of chill in the air in the low parts of the mountain.


Today we seem to have happened upon the very time of blooming of the elder trees, so the air along the trail was amazingly fragrant. We gathered a bunch of elder flowers and I'm making an elder lemonade right now.

Strawberry Cheesecake

Gaby had been sending me pictures of the strawberry cheesecakes she made lately for various occasions, making my mouth water, so in the end I asked her for the recipe and made a strawberry cheesecake myself. Mine is a lighter version of the original and it was a great success with husband and son, so I'm writing down the recipe, as I improvised it yesterday:

INGREDIENTS:

For the biscuit layer 

  • 150 g biscuits
  • 75 g melted butter 


For the cheese cream layer 

  • 100 g cheese cream
  • 400 g sour cream
  • 50 g milk 
  • 120 g sugar
  • 2 eggs
  • a pinch of salt


For the strawberry layer 

  • 500 g strawberries
  • 1 pack red cake glaze
  • 30 g sugar
  • 200 g water 

PREPARATION:

Grind the biscuits, stir in the melted butter and transfer the biscuit mixture into a cake form. Compact the biscuit layer with the bottom of a glass and leave to cool in the fridge for a few minutes.

Meanwhile prepare the batter for the cheese cream layer. Pour it over the biscuit layer and place the cake form in a preheated oven and bake at 175C for one hour. After the cake is baked, leave it to cool completely for a couple of  hours. 

Cut the strawberries into slices and arrange them tile-like on top of the cake. Prepare the cake glaze - mix the powder glaze with the sugar, add the water and cook on the hot plate until it thickens. Leave it to rest for one minute, then spread it on top of the strawberries with the help of a silicon brush. 

Leave the cake to cool in the fridge for a couple of hours or overnight. Serve with coffee and enjoy!
